we have brought up a web server which allows you to create HDR images
on-line. The engine under the bonnet is Greg's hdrgen (thanks Greg!).
You may upload up to 9 JPEG images, totalling 5MB. The results you get
back are a RADIANCE image and a false colour JPEG.
For now, you can only hit it with the default option. No command-line
switches are implemented yet. When the future of hdrgen becomes clear,
we will implement more sophisticated control over the HDR generation.
It's an old K6-II 500 box, so be patient.
